暂时未有相关云产品技术能力~
小麦苗,专注于数据库,Oracle OCM,PostgreSQL PGCM,PostgreSQL ACE,中国PG分会官方认证讲师,PGfans签约作者,PGfans年度MVP;微信公众号: DB宝,个人网站:www.xmmup.com
ORA-01555 快照太旧、Undo表空间、一致性读、延时块清除 回滚与撤销 回滚与撤销: 为了保证数据库中多个用户间的读一致性和能够回退事务,Oracle必须拥有一种机制,能够为变更的数据构造一种前镜像(before image)数据(保存修改之前的旧值),以保证那够回滚或撤销对数据库所作的修改,同时为数据恢复以及一致性读服务。
第一章 Oracle内核系列3-揭秘ASM磁盘头信息 DBAplus社群 | 2015-12-17 07:00 1ASM元数据 1.1基础概念 1.1.1 ASM File 从10g开始,数据文件的存储除了使用裸设备和文件系统外,还可以存放在ASM中。
第一章 Oracle内核系列2-揭秘Oracle数据库truncate原理 DBAplus社群 | 2015-11-30 23:45 一、Truncate简介 无数次事故告诉我们,Truncate是一项很危险的动作。
第一章 看了此文,Oracle SQL优化文章不必再看! DBAplus社群 | 2015-11-17 23:44 目录SQL优化的本质 SQL优化Road Map 2.
DBAplus社群 | 2016-02-03 07:47 本文作者通过身边的案例,详细阐述了SQL优化过程中的种种方法和小窍门,内容丰富且言之有物,希望能让接触到SQL的同学可以体会到SQL提速的乐趣! 1.前言 关于SQL优化,前辈们、技术大咖们、各个技术论坛上早就有很多的优秀文章,今番我再次提起,心情忐忑,实在是有些班门弄斧和自不量力了。
Oracle | 2016-02-05 08:37 在 Oracle 数据库的运行过程中,可能会因为一些异常遇到数据库挂起失去响应的状况,在这种状况下,我们可以通过对系统状态进行转储,获得跟踪文件进行数据库问题分析;很多时候数据库也会自动转储出现问题的进程或系统信息;这些转储信息成为我们分析故障、排查问题的重要依据。
作者:唐小丹(浙江移动数据库管理员) 周 凯(上海新炬数据库工程师) 相信很多Oracle DBA在职业生涯中或多或少都遇到过这样的情况:数据文件被误删了,存储坏了无法识别数据文件,最糟糕的是,竟然rman备份也是坏的…… 遇到问题凌乱慌张是没用的,而贸然动手也是非常危险的,当遇到紧急问题,最重要的就是冷静分析,临危不乱。
第一章 Oracle hang 之sqlplus -prelim使用方法 很多情况下,Oracle hang导致sqlplus无法连接,从而无法获得Oracle系统和进程状态,使得定位问题缺少强有力的依据。
第一章 新春巨献: 80 多个 Linux 系统管理员必备的监控工具 随着互联网行业的不断发展,各种监控工具多得不可胜数。这里列出网上最全的监控工具。
杨建荣的学习笔记 | 2016-02-09 22:28 最近收到报警,某一个服务器的swap空间有些紧张,查看这台服务器上有两个备库数据库实例,当然负载还是很低的。
第一章 数据安全:巧妙解决由密码过期导致的用户锁定问题 数据库安全问题一直是人们关注的焦点。oracle数据库使用了多种手段来保证数据库的安全,如密码,角色,权限等等。
本篇整理内容是黄廷忠在“云和恩墨大讲堂”微信分享中的讲解案例,SQL优化及SQL审核,是从源头解决性能问题的根本手段,无论是开发人员还是DBA,都应当持续深入的学习SQL开发技能,从而为解决性能问题打下根基。
当执行datapump导出和导入时都想尽一切办法来提高性能,这里介绍一些可以显著提高DataPump性能的相关DataPump与数据库参数 一.影响DataPump相关的DataPump参数 access_method 在某些情况下由Data Pump API所选择的方法不能快速的访问你的数据集。
昨天用户报告数据库不能启动了,询问用户,用户也不清楚原因。在解决过程中遇到了ORA-01189的问题,查遍了网上,包括metalink,也没有找到合适的解决方案,差点就放弃了......还好,根据ORACLE的错误解释,终于摸索出了下面的解决方法。
一、首先删除原有控制文件并新建控制文件 1、找到控制文件位置 SQL> show parameter control_files; NAME TYPE VALUE -------------------------...
--16进制转10进制,用to_number,里面的参数是16进制的数据,且参数用单引号括起SQL> select to_number('ff','xx') from dual; TO_NUMBER('FF','XX')--------------...
oracle rba相当重要,与oracle恢复及redo内容,检查点进程工作机制,有密不可分的关系与联系;理解它的构成,是进一步深入学习oracle必备路途 摘贴网上基于rba的文章:http://blog.
df命令查看自己的/目录属于哪个逻辑卷(我们要做的是对逻辑卷扩展) [root@redhat6-3 ~]# df Filesystem 1K-blocks Used Available Use% Moun...
【AIX】3004-314 Password was recently used and is not valid for reuse 一.
【BBED】编译及基本命令(1) 1.1 BLOG文档结构图 1.2 前言部分 1.
利用kfed的repair命令修复asm头块,碰到这个错误。 错误信息如下: $kfed repair /dev/rhdisk3 KFED-00320: Invalid block num1 = [3], num2 = [1], error = [type_kfbh] 导致这个错误的原因是由于当前磁盘组的AUSIZE不是默认值1M,而是4M。
当我们在一台机器上跑多个实例或者需要对某个用户进行资源限制,profile可以轻松帮助你实现这些功能。 profile:配置文件的名称。Oracle数据库以以下方式强迫资源限制: 1、如果用户超过了connect_time或idle_time的会话资源限制,数据库就回滚当前事务,并结束会话。
ORALCE10G 位图索引探究 1. 实验目的 研究对oracle数据库位图索引进行DML操作的探究,加深理解位图索引的原理,指导实践中的应用。
/************************************************************** Table: SYS.T_PARTITION_RANGE** Number of Records: 10000***************...
【RAC】rac中如何指定job的运行实例 1.1 BLOG文档结构图 1.2 前言部分 1.
原文已删除
【技巧】如何全文搜索oracle官方文档 一.1 BLOG文档结构图 一.2 导读和注意事项 各位技术爱好者,看完本文后,你可以掌握如下的技能,也可以学到一些其它你所不知道的知识,~O(∩_∩)O~: ① 如何在线和离线查看oracle官方...
今天处理了一起因异步IO没有开启导致Oracle的SQL*Plus不可用的故障。记录在此,供参考。1.故障场景 情况是这样的,系统是使用IBM的HACMP做的两节点HA,在第一个节点部署完Oracle(11.1.0.6)并在挂载的存储上创建完数据库后,使用tar方法将第一个节点上的Oracle软件解tar到第二个节点上完成软件安装。
相关文章: 《Oracle Database RAC 11.2.0.3 for AIX6.1TL7安装记录(1)》:http://blog.itpub.net/23135684/viewspace-733990/ 《Oracle Database RAC 11.
该方案是利用AIX LVM和IBM HACMP软件创建并行的LV镜像作为OCR、Votedisk的第3张盘,实践证明这种方案是不可行的!服务器一旦断电,可能导致LV镜像磁盘与其它两个磁盘的数据不同步,Clusterware无法正常的启动。
一、问题描述 使用sqlplus时,连接到业务用户时,想查看某SQL的执行计划,报【SP2-0618: Cannot find the Session Identifier. Check PLUSTRACE role is enabled】和【SP2-0611: Error enabling STATISTICS report】,通过相关文档检索后得知原因是缺少plus trace ROLE的权限,解决思路:赋予用户plustrace 权限即可。
用直接路径(direct-path)insert提升性能的两种方法 本文属于转载内容,原文地址:http://mp.weixin.qq.com/s?__biz=MzA4MDcyNzc0NQ==&mid=402689013&idx=2&sn=5f57...
这篇文章将通过两篇MOS文章来讨论AIX平台下为磁盘分配PVID对ASM磁盘的破坏。文章一: 这篇文章说明的是对一个存在的ASM磁盘分配PVID将破坏ASM的磁盘头,导致ASM磁盘组无法正常MOUNT。
在RAC安装过程中涉及多个用户,多种工具,这里列出常见命令提示符: # UNIX的SHELL提示符,表示root用户的登录 $ UNIX的SHELL提示符,表示oracl用户或grid用户的登录 安装RAC是一个比较耗时,并且容易出错的过程。
【安装】AIX安装单实例11gR2 GRID+DB 1.1 BLOG文档结构图 1.
SQL> alter system set log_archive_dest_1='e:\oracle11g\archivelog';alter system set log_archive_dest_1='e:\oracle11g\archivelog'*第 1 行...
【OEM】OEM安装维护 1.1 BLOG文档结构图 1.2 前言部分 1.
【故障处理】修改SPFILE无权限 一.1 BLOG文档结构图 一.2 前言部分 一.2.1 导读和注意事项 各位技术爱好者,看完本文后,你可以掌握如下的技能,也可以学到一些其它你所不知道的知识,~O(∩_∩)O~: ① 修改spfi...
【RAC安装故障处理】multiple user has uid 0 一.1 BLOG文档结构图 一.2 前言部分 一.2.1 导读和注意事项 各位技术爱好者,看完本文后,你可以掌握如下的技能,也可以学到一些其它你所不知道的知识,~O...
下面是再一次安装Oracle 11.2.0.3 RAC Database for AIX6.1 TL7遇到问题的记录,之前还有两篇记录文章:《Oracle Database RAC 11.
今天再次在AIX 6.1 TL7上安装一套Oracle Database RAC 11.2.0.3,再次遇到N多问题,在此记录这些问题。《Oracle Database RAC 11.
下面的步骤详细的说明了在Oracle 11gR2 RAC Database环境下使用emca配置集群dbconsole遇到的部分问题及解决的方法。1.数据库环境。Oracle Exadata Machine x4-2Oracle RAC Database 11.2.0.4.6 for Linux x86_64bit[root@dm01db01 ~]# uname -r2.6.39-400.126.1.el5uek2.使用EMCA创建EM。
问: Oracle数据库的SGA包含db block buffer cache和redo buffer等组件,那么,同样属于内存,buffer cache和buffer有区别吗? 答:首先我们对比一下db block buffer cache和redo buffer的概念和功能。
在AIX平台安装Oracle RAC就是个坑爹的事情,今日再次验证了这点,只因为bug太多!记录问题也只因为bug太多!强烈推荐及看好Oracle RAC在Linux平台的发展。
今天上PUB看见一位热心人汇总了这么个地址列表,转发来空间: 把下面的地址复制到讯雷里就可以下载. --------------------------------------------------------------------------...
shell will time out in 60 secondsksh: timed out waiting for input 在工作过程中,经常连接到客户的服务器上后,出现上述连接中断,通过设置 export TMOUT=0 解决该问题 [@more@] ...
客户原本是一套单机版的Oracle 11.2.0.3.0 Database for Windows的数据库系统,客户的需求是将单机版的Oracle Database迁移到3节点的Oracle RAC Database中,并且平台变成Linux,但数据库版本不变化。
在使用rman duplicate复制standby数据库的时候,由于standby数据库实例必须处于非mount状态,所以主数据库直接连接是会报错的,需要在standby数据库服务上的监听器上配置静态的服务名,如下:$GRID_HOME/network/admin/listener.
【DG】主rac + 备rac dg 部署 一.1 BLOG文档结构图 一.2 前言部分 一.2.1 导读和注意事项 各位技术爱好者,看完本文后,你可以掌握如下的技能,也可以学到一些其它你所不知道的知识,~O(∩_∩)O~: ① 主库...
AIX 开机自动挂载NFS共享 当Oracle搭建在AIX系统上,进行集中备份时,可能需要通过连接Backup server挂载NFS共享来讲数据备份到存储设备上。